Step 2: Analyze Search Intent
Users search for different reasons. Understanding their intent ensures your content meets their needs.
- Informational: Users want to learn (e.g., “Facebook algorithm explained”).
- Navigational: Users seek a specific page (e.g., “Facebook Business Manager login”).
- Transactional: Users want to take action (e.g., “Buy Facebook ads”).

3. Content Strategies for Audience Growth
Content is the backbone of your Facebook strategy. Posting the right type of content at the right time keeps your audience engaged and encourages new followers.
Engagement-Driven Post Types
Content Type | Engagement Tip | Best Posting Time |
---|---|---|
Live Videos | Host Q&As, behind-the-scenes | 12-3 PM (Local Time) |
Reels | Use trending audio & effects | 7-9 PM |
Polls/Quizzes | Encourage opinions on new products | 10 AM-12 PM |
User-Generated Content (UGC) | Share customer testimonials & stories | Anytime |
Pro Tip: UGC generates 29% higher engagement than brand-created content.

5. Promotion & Collaboration
Influencer Partnerships
Type | Follower Count | Engagement Level |
---|---|---|
Micro-Influencers | 10k – 100k | High (More authentic interactions) |
Macro-Influencers | 100k – 1M | Moderate |
Celebrities | 1M+ | High reach, but lower engagement |
Pro Tip: Collaborate with niche influencers who have high engagement rates instead of focusing solely on follower count.

6. Monitoring & Iteration
Facebook success requires continuous improvement.
Metric | Benchmark | Tool |
---|---|---|
Engagement Rate | 3-6% | Facebook Insights |
Reach | 10% of followers | Facebook Insights |
Click-Through Rate (CTR) | 1-2% (Organic), 5-10% (Paid) | Facebook Ads Manager |
Pro Tip: Use Facebook’s A/B testing feature to see what content works best and optimize accordingly.
